Long March 2D launches Zhangheng-1 Earthquake investigator
A Long March 2D has conducted the sixth Chinese launch of 2018, with the lofting of the Zhangheng-1 spacecraft, a new research satellite for the observation of ionospheric precursors of earthquakes. Long March 2C launches Yaogan Weixing-30 Group-4
China launched the fourth group of triplet satellites for the Chuangxin-5 (CX-5) constellation. Launched under the name Yaogan Weixing-30 Group-4, the three satellites were orbited by a Long March-2C launch vehicle from the LC3 Launch Complex of the Xichang Satellite Launch Center. Long March 11 in multiple satellite launch
China conducted its fourth orbital launch of 2018 using a Long March 11 rocket – this time carrying six small satellites into orbit. China launches latest Beidou-3M satellite duo
A new pair of navigation satellites were successfully launched by China on Thursday, using a Long March-3B/YZ-1. The launch of the Beidou-3M pair took place at around 23:18 UTC from the LC2 Launch Complex of the Xichang Satellite Launch Center, Sichuan province. It took over four hours to complete the mission. Long March 2D launches SuperView duo
The second pair of Gaojing-1 (SuperView-1) satellites were launched from the Taiyuan Satellite Launch Center on Tuesday. This was the first launch of 2018 for China and took place at 03:24 UTC from the LC9 launch complex using a Long March-2D launch vehicle.
